Glenmorangie Front of House Assistant
Glenmorangie, a distinguished member of the LVMH Moët Hennessy family, is renowned for crafting some of Scotland's most celebrated single malt whiskies, including Glenmorangie and Ardbeg. As an employer, Glenmorangie is committed to fostering a diverse and inclusive work environment that reflects the varied needs of its workforce. The company offers flexible working arrangements and generous leave entitlements, supporting both mental and physical wellbeing. As a Disability Committed Employer, Glenmorangie ensures equal opportunities for all applicants, particularly those with disabilities.
- Act as an ambassador for the Glenmorangie brand, passionately advocating its values.
- Manage the check-in process, including welcoming guests, conducting house tours, and confirming guest requirements.
- Ensure presentation standards are consistently met for all public areas.
- Engage with customers to educate them on the food and whisky journey.
- Support Senior Front of House staff in setting up and delivering tastings.
- Maintain a comprehensive knowledge of company products and services.
- Ensure stock levels of all consumables are maintained.
- Adhere to Health & Safety policies and procedures at Glenmorangie House.
